Yay for Sasha Cohen and Kimmie Meisner. Their short programs on Tuesday were amazing. I think Slutskaya so didn't deserve to be in 1st...at least not by that much over Meisner. Sure, she's technically sound and amazing but she has NOO artistic flair whatsoever. Not to mention that Slutskaya started with a triple-double and Meisner began her program with a triple-triple (one of the hardest jump combos).

Currently, the standing are:
1. Sasha Cohen (USA) 66.73 pts,
2. Irina Slutskaya (RUS) 66.70,
3. Shizuka Arakawa (JPN) 66.02,
4. Fumie Suguri (JPN) 61.75,
5. Kimmie Meissner (USA) 59.40,
6. Elene Gedevanishvili (GEO) 57.90,
7. Emily Hughes (USA) 57.08,
8. Miki Ando (JPN) 56.00,
9. Joannie Rochette (CAN) 55.85,
10. Sarah Meier (SUI) 55.57,
